Understanding Bundler Analytics

What do the analytics in Atlas Bundler mean and how can I use them?

How to Access Your Bundle Analytics

  1. In your Shopify admin, go to Apps > Atlas Bundler

  2. At the top of the app interface, click the Analytics tab

  3. From here, you’ll see a dashboard showing performance across all your active bundles

Use the dropdown at the top to filter analytics by bundle or view overall performance.

Key Metrics

Visitors
Tracks how many unique visitors are seeing your bundles. This helps you understand how much exposure your offers are getting.

Bundle Orders
Shows the number of completed orders that include one or more bundles. A great indicator of how many customers are acting on your offers.

Conversion to Bundle
This is the percentage of visitors who added a bundle to their cart and completed checkout. Use it to measure how persuasive your offer setup is.

Added Revenue
Displays the total revenue generated through bundles — above your product’s regular price. This tells you how much financial lift your bundles are creating.

Graphs and Visual Insights

Bundle Conversion Graph
See how your bundle conversion rate changes over time. Great for tracking performance improvements after changes or campaigns.

Daily Added Revenue Graph
Shows daily added revenue from bundle sales. Use this to identify trends, campaign impact, and peak performance periods.

Tips for Maximizing Bundle Performance

  • Test different types of bundles (e.g., BOGO vs. Volume Discount)

  • Change placement and styling to improve visibility

  • Monitor performance regularly and iterate based on results

  • Keep copy clear, direct, and value-focused

  • Watch for the upcoming Revenue Per User metric for deeper optimization
